|
@@ -44,8 +44,8 @@ public class EvaluationDeptBusinessContentServiceImpl extends ServiceImpl<Evalua
|
|
|
for (EvaluationDeptBusinessContent evaluationDeptBusinessContent : evaluationDeptBusinessContentList) {
|
|
|
if (StringUtils.isEmpty(evaluationDeptBusinessContent.getId())) {
|
|
|
List<OrganizationStructure> organizationStructureList = organizationStructureService.getTree("23031001", 1, "140");
|
|
|
- OrganizationStructure organizationStructure = organizationStructureList.stream().filter(item -> item.getId().equals(evaluationDeptBusinessContent.getDeptId())).findFirst().orElse(null);
|
|
|
- if (ObjectUtil.isNotNull(organizationStructure)){
|
|
|
+ OrganizationStructure organizationStructure = organizationStructureList.get(0).getChildren().stream().filter(item -> item.getId().equals(evaluationDeptBusinessContent.getDeptId())).findFirst().orElse(null);
|
|
|
+ if (null !=organizationStructure){
|
|
|
evaluationDeptBusinessContent.setDeptName(organizationStructure.getName());
|
|
|
evaluationDeptBusinessContent.setCreateTime(DateUtil.date());
|
|
|
b = super.save(evaluationDeptBusinessContent);
|